The most common reason: a door that is not tightly closed
Most often, the cause of anxiety turns out to be extremely simple and banal - one of the household members simply did not close the door completely. In modern models, the timer operates 30–60 seconds after the door is no longer airtight. This time is given to the user to quickly remove the product and close the compartment. If the delay is prolonged, an intermittent squeak is heard intermittent squeak.
However, it happens that visually the door seems closed, but the signal does not stop. In this case, the culprit could be a small object stuck in the seal, or a build-up of ice on the inner shelf that prevents a tight seal. It is also worth checking to see if a bottle or jar has turned over, which now rests on the shelf from above and does not allow the door to close.
⚠️ Attention: If you checked all the shelves and found nothing, try gently pressing the door along the entire area of the seal. Sometimes the latch mechanism can jam, and a slight force helps to complete the system.
Another hidden factor is door misalignment. Over time, heavy shelves or rough handling can cause the hinges to become sagging and the door physically unable to snap into place without pressing hard. In this case, sealing rubber does not fit, warm air penetrates inside, the sensor detects the increase in temperature and turns on the alarm. There is only one solution here - adjusting or replacing the hinges.
Overload and disruption of air circulation
If everything is in order with the door, you should look inside the chamber. A refrigerator is not a warehouse, but a complex thermal unit that needs free space to circulate cold air. When you put a freshly cooked hot pot of soup inside or fill the compartments to capacity, the temperature rises sharply.
The electronics detect that the inside has become warmer than it should operation modeand begins to “scream” about it. Models with a system No Frostare especially sensitive to this, where air flows are distributed strictly along channels. If you block the outlet openings of the air ducts with packages or food, the temperature sensor will show a false alarm.
- 🔥 Hot products: Never put food in the refrigerator that is higher than room temperature. This causes stress on the compressor and an increase in temperature throughout the chamber.
- 📦 Dense loading: Leave gaps between the products and the back wall for free circulation of air masses.
- 🌡️ Long opening: If you spent a long time choosing yogurt while holding the door open, (the compressor) does not have time to cool the volume, and the signal timer is triggered.
To fix the problem, just remove the excess items, let the chamber cool and close the door. If the squeaking stops 10–15 minutes after the conditions return to normal, it means that the equipment is working properly and you simply violated the operating rules.
Power problems and power surges
Sometimes the refrigerator starts beeping not because of internal problems, but because of the quality of power in your network. Power surges, short-term blackouts or poor contact in the socket can be perceived by the electronic control module as an emergency.
When the power supply is restored, many modern models (for example, Samsung or Electrolux) emit a signal, indicating that the operating cycle has been interrupted. This is a safety feature that lets you know that food may have defrosted while you were away from home. In some cases, an indicator may light up on the display indicating a failure.
How to distinguish a power failure from a breakdown?
If a squeak is heard once or in series immediately after turning on the lights in the house, and the temperature inside the chamber is normal, this is a reaction to a power surge. If the squeak is constant and is accompanied by warmth inside, look for another reason.
To protect expensive equipment from such surprises, it is recommended to use voltage stabilizers or at least high-quality surge protectors. Frequent changes can damage not only the sensors, but also the main one compressor, the repair of which will cost much more.
Faults in the defrosting system and frost
If you are the owner of a refrigerator with the system No Frost, but a “coat” of ice has formed inside, or in the usual model the ice crust has become too thick, expect problems. A clogged drain hole is one of the most common reasons why equipment starts beeping.
When water from melted ice cannot go into the drain, it freezes, blocking the operation of the evaporator or defrost sensors. The system “thinks” that defrosting was not successful and reports an error. In this case, the squeak is often accompanied by blinking indicators on the control panel.
☑️ Defrost system diagnostics
To solve the problem, it is often necessary to completely defrost the refrigerator within 24 hours. It is necessary to unplug the device, open the doors and allow the ice to melt naturally. Do not use a hair dryer or a knife to chip ice - this may damage evaporator tubes or the plastic box, which will lead to freon leakage.
⚠️ Attention: If after complete defrosting (at least 24 hours) the refrigerator starts beeping again after a few days, there is a problem lies in the malfunction of the defrost system components: heating element, timer or sensor. Diagnostics with a multimeter is required.
Technical faults: sensors and thermostats
When all external factors are excluded, we have to talk about the failure of internal components. The most common technical reason is a breakdown of thermal sensor or the thermostat. These elements are responsible for temperature control. If the sensor “lies” and shows the control module that the chamber is +10°C instead of the required +4°C, the emergency mode and sound alarm are activated.
In older models with mechanical control, the thermostat is responsible for this. Its contacts may oxidize or stick, which is why the compressor does not turn on on time, and the warning light (or buzzer) works constantly. In modern digital models, temperature sensors (thermistors) change their resistance when heating or cooling. An open circuit or short circuit in the sensor is immediately detected by the control board.
Diagnostics of such faults requires special knowledge and tools. The technician must “ring” the sensor, check its resistance at different temperatures and compare the readings with reference values for a specific model. Self-replacement is possible if you know how to read electrical diagrams and get to the sensor installation location without damaging the insulation.

When is it time to call a repairman?
There is a fine line between something that you can fix yourself and a situation that requires professional intervention. If you have completed all the steps: checked the door, defrosted the unit, made sure that the voltage is stable, and the signal does not stop, it’s time to call service.
The symptoms are especially alarming when, along with a squeaking sound, the refrigerator stops freezing, the compressor works without stopping or, conversely, does not start at all. Also, do not ignore the burning smell or humming noise that is unusual for normal engine operation. In these cases, delay can lead to a complete replacement of the refrigeration unit.
Remember that modern technology is a complex mechanism. An attempt at deep repairs without qualifications can lead to damage freon circuit, which will make restoration economically unfeasible. It is better to entrust the diagnosis to professionals who have access to original spare parts and circuits.
Why does the refrigerator squeak after defrosting?
If the squeaking started immediately after you defrosted the refrigerator and turned it on, this may be normal. The electronics need time (from 2 to 12 hours) to gain temperature and “realize” that everything is in order. During this period, sensors can detect a sharp jump in heat and signal about it. However, if more than 12 hours have passed and the signal does not stop, you may have damaged the sensor during defrosting or flooded the electrical contacts with water.
Is it possible to turn off the sound permanently?
In most models, it is impossible to completely turn off the alarm sound signal, as this is an important safety feature. However, you can mute the sound by pressing the button (it usually flashes along with the sound). This confirms that you are aware of the problem. But the malfunction indicator itself will remain on until the cause is eliminated.
The refrigerator beeps, but freezes normally. What to do?
If the temperature is normal, but there is a squeaking sound, most likely the problem is a “glitch” in the electronics or a stuck button on the control panel. Try doing a hard reset: unplug the refrigerator for 15–20 minutes. If this does not help, the buzzer itself (beeper) or the control module that is sending a false signal may be faulty.
How can you tell that the sensor has burned out?
It is difficult to accurately determine without a multimeter, but there are indirect signs. If the refrigerator “thinks” that it’s hot in the chamber (the compressor hums continuously, ice freezes), but it’s really cold inside (food freezes), the sensor probably shows a false high temperature. If the compressor is silent, and the chamber is warm, the sensor could be “stuck” in a cold state.
